SE-EPI-06-m, march 9, 2012. 1. f eatures ? red led?s indicate presence of voltage to ground for each phase of a power system. o redundant led?s are used for reliability. ? pressing lamp test causes all led?s to light. n ote : the lamp test feature requires an isolated 120 vac supply. ? direct connection for voltages up to 600 vac line to line. o potential transformers (pt?s) are required for voltages greater than 600 vac. 2. d escription the SE-EPI-06 is a self-powered voltage indication system. presence of phase-to -ground voltage is indicated by redundant led?s (two per phase). the respective led?s are on when voltage is present. 3. i nstallation outline and panel-mounting details are shown in fig. 1. for 208- to 600-vac systems, connect the SE-EPI-06 directly to the three-phase bus. for 208- or 240-volt installations, use terminals al, bl, and cl. for systems above 240 v and up to 600 v, use terminals ah, bh, and ch. see figs. 2 and 4. for systems above 600 v, install pt?s as shown in figs. 3 and 5. connect terminal g and chassis-bonding terminal ( ) to ground. for lamp test connect 120 vac supply to l and g. connection and use of lamp test circuit is optional. ah al bh bl ch cl 108.0 (4.25) 95.3 (3.75) 76.2 (3.00) 88.9 (3.50) 6.4 (0.25) 95.3 (3.75) 6.4 (0.25) 76.2 (3.00) 101.6 (4.00) 69.9 (2.75) 3.2 (0.13) faceplate outline 4.0 (0.16) dia 6.4 (0.25) r mounting detail front side 52.4 (2.06) abc energized phase lamp l a m p test t e s t SE-EPI-06 rev: phase voltage: phase current: lamp-test supply: 208-600 vac 50/60 hz 50 ma maximum 1 va 120 vac 50/60 hz SE-EPI-06 energized phase indicator serial no: 00 elxxxxyyyyy 1-800-tec-fuse (1-800-832-3873) made in saskatoon, canada lr 53428 us c r figure 1. SE-EPI-06-m, march 9, 2012. 4. t echnical s pecifications phase voltage input l, maximums ......... 240 vac to ground, 3.5 ma input h, maximums ......... 600 vac to ground, 4.5 ma lamp test input ..................... isolated 120 vac, 1 va maximum dielectric strength .................. 2,200 vac, 1 minute shipping weight ..................... 0.3 kg (0.8 lb.) dimensions: height .............................. 108 mm (4.3?) weight ............................. 88.9 mm (3.5?) depth ............................... 54 mm (2.1?) environment: operating temperature ....... -40 to 60 ? c storage temperature .......... -55 to 80 ? c humidity ............................ 85 % non-condensing pwb conformal coating ....... mil-1-46058 qualified ul qmju2 recognized certification ............................ csa, canada and usa lr 53428 us c r ul listed
